Ilkley is a spa town and civil parish in West Yorkshire, in Northern England. In the past part of the West Riding of Yorkshire, Ilkley civil parish consists of the neighbouring village of Ben Rhydding, and it is a ward within the city borough of the City of Bradford. Being around 12 miles (19 kilometres) north of Bradford and 17 miles (27 km) northwest of Leeds, the town is set primarily on the south shore of the River Wharfe in Wharfedale, one of the Yorkshire Dales. According to the 2011 Census, there is a permanent resident population of 14809. Within this population, 20.73 percent are aged between 45 and 59 years old, composing the largest age group in the town. As a result of Ilkley's spa town heritage and surrounding countryside, tourism is an essential regional trade. Ilkley is a shopping town that sells everything from video game, fine wine, high-end clothing and artwork. Located in the restored Victorian arcade, the shopping centre is complete with a fountain and hanging baskets. Also, local companies feature the Woolmark Company, Spooner Industries and NG Bailey. The town is additionally the home of two breweries, Ilkley Brewery situated on the outskirts, and Wharfedale Brewery which is housed within the grounds of a former 18th-century farmhouse in the town centre. The town centre is characterised by Victorian architecture, wide streets and flower shows. Ilkley Moor, to the south of the town, is the subject of a folk song, frequently referred to as the unofficial anthem of Yorkshire, 'On Ilkla Moor Baht 'at'. The song's words are written in Yorkshire dialect, its title translated as 'On Ilkley Moor without a hat.' How To Hire A Handyman

With so many individuals having not-so-good experiences with handymen, hiring one can be a very difficult task. If you’re also looking for the best way to hire a handyman, then you’d have probably heard some stories of them not showing up, not returning calls or delivering an awful service after promising heaven and earth.

However, the reality is there are also a number of people who have enjoyed the several handy skills these “small job guys have got. Some who actually return calls, show up and also come true of their promises. So how do you become one of those people that’ll have a great story to tell about these handymen? Well, in this article, you’d probably learn a thing or two on the best approach to hiring a handyman that’ll not only provide you with a high quality service, but also display an all-round professionalism and excellent customer service.

• Be Organized. Make a list of all repair and maintenance services required and establish a budget for them. You can use free online pricing tools like Home Advisor’s True Cost Guide to learn more about repair costs.

• Prioritize Your Tasks. Your repair list should be made in order of priority.

• Compare Your Prices. Ensure that your handyman is familiar with the repairs and compare the prices. The handyman’s price quotes can be a little bit higher, but more attention should be placed on obviously inconsistent pricing.

• Search For References. It’s important to request references of previous work. If the handyman has low quality work samples or negative references, then you might want to steer clear and find another handyman.

• Discuss Payment. If you have multiple projects to be done, it’s advisable to structure your payments around task completions. Do not even consider hiring a handyman who requests a full upfront payment.

How Much Should I Pay A Handyman Per Hour?

Are you about to hire the services of a handyman and probably wondering how much their services cost per hour is? Well, you’re at the right place! The price to be charged by a handyman typically depends on the type of work being carried out, but it’s usually within the range of £20 to £30 per hour. Another typical handyman pricing is project pricing rather than charging of a hourly rate. So when you’re being charged based on the project, you can also ensure to ask for possible discounts as there are often discounts available for larger quantities of jobs or tasks that can be completed one after the other. For smaller, one-off jobs there’s a likely possibility for a minimum charge to surface. As a result, you can expect to pay a premium for the first hour of a handyman’s professional service but a smaller charge for subsequent hours after the first. This is mainly due to the fact that a handyman will need to travel to deliver a service and it’s generally going to be a lot more economical to arrive on the site and take on a couple of tasks sequentially.

There’s a couple of varying handyman’s pricing strategies which is important to be aware of before moving forward. These includes hourly rate, charging by project as well as regular discount or bulk discount. However, if you’re loyal and stick to one handyman, they’ll generally reward your loyalty by looking at your best interest when it comes to the pricing of your projects. This showcases the obvious economy in dealing with one handyman over time and as you build a solid relationship, they’ll also get to know more about you and your projects which will enable them finish the tasks more effectively and efficiently.
